Lynch is moderately more affordable than Indianola, with a 7.8% lower cost of living index. Indianola scores 58 compared to 54 for Lynch,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Indianola can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

On the housing front, median rent in Indianola is $639/month compared to $573/month in Lynch — a 12%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Lynch is more affordable at $58,500 median vs $85,500.

Median household income in Indianola is $49,615 compared to $37,014 in Lynch (+34%). While Indianola is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Indianola spend roughly 15.5% of their income on rent, less than the 18.6% in Lynch.

Climate-wise, Indianola is notably warmer with an average of 52.2°F compared to 48.7°F in Lynch. Lynch receives more rainfall at 28.7" per year compared to 20.1" in Indianola.
